...FLOOD WARNING NOW IN EFFECT UNTIL 4 AM EDT EARLY THIS MORNING...


* WHAT...Small stream and creek flooding caused by excessive
rainfall continues.

* WHERE...A portion of southeast Ohio, including the following
county, Jackson.

* WHEN...Until 400 AM EDT.

* IMPACTS...Flooding of rivers, creeks, streams, and other low-lying
and flood-prone locations is imminent or occurring. Streams
continue to rise due to excess runoff from earlier rainfall.
Low-water crossings are inundated with water and may not be
passable.

* ADDITIONAL DETAILS...
- At 150 AM EDT, local law enforcement reported heavy rain in
the warned area. Flooding is already occurring. Between 1.5
and 2.5 inches of rain have fallen.
- Additional rainfall amounts less than 0.2 inches are possible
in the warned area.
- Some locations that will experience flooding include...
Jackson, Wellston, Coalton and Petersburg.

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

Turn around, don`t drown when encountering flooded roads. Most flood
deaths occur in vehicles.

Be especially cautious at night when it is harder to recognize the
dangers of flooding.

Stay away or be swept away. River banks and culverts can become
unstable and unsafe.
